Impatiens Holstii
Impatiens Holstii flowers are beautiful most widely grown ornamental ground cover, they create a stunning flower. It can provide a lot of colors to your garden also known as Busy Lizzie.? The name that describes because of the apparent impatience which the way they discharge their seeds from its pods when ripe.
Planting & Care?
SunLight:? these plants should be subject to hot direct sunlight, but they do need bright light.
Soil: requires a loamy soil with a ph of 6.1 – 7.5 – it grows best in weakly acidic soil – weakly alkaline soil.
Water:? Do not let dry out. Plants require plenty of water, especially with high temperatures.
Fertilizer:?You can mix in compost or a slow-release fertilizer before transplanting to help the plants.
Temperature:? Normal room temperatures are suitable but at temperatures about 24?C (75?F) these plants like high humidity.
